Positive aspects of school
My teacher, Jesús, was excellent! Seriously, one of the best teachers I've ever seen. The office staff were all friendly and helpful.
Negative aspects
The school is fine, really it is. My only negative comments would relate to the town of Heredia itself. It's a little bit slummy and not very interesting, but even at that, I got used to being there.
Insider tips about what future students should not miss
If you can study with Jesús, by all means do! Unfortunately I don't know anything about the other teachers. If they're all at his level, this is a great place.
Other comments
All in all, it was a very positive experience.
City/place
I do not recommend Heredia particularly, although I did get used to being there. The downtown area especially looks like a slum. I came home one day to find a guy sleeping on the sidewalk in front of my door. I did find a couple of good restaurants. But safety -- no. The school held an evening event at a bar two short blocks from my homestay, and it was strongly recommended that I take a taxi home. Really?!
Quality of teaching / language progress
The last two of the three weeks I was the only student at my level, so the class time was cut in half. I was a little disappointed, but Jesús really worked me hard, so I guess it worked out even.
Accommodation
Alice was very nice and very accommodating. I feel that I got a very good picture of life there.
